Suprasellar Versus Third Ventricular Cysts: Anatomic and Surgical Considerations.
Roy Chebel1, Joyce Koueik, Vivek Sivan
1Departments of Neurological Surgery, University of Wisconsin, Madison , Wisconsin , USA.
Suprasellar arachnoid cysts (SACs) and third ventricular cysts (3VCs) can cause obstructive hydrocephalus. Endoscopic surgery offers a solution, but requires understanding cyst-induced anatomical distortion for safe and effective treatment.

Background:
- Intracranial arachnoid cysts are common, benign cerebrospinal fluid-filled sacs.
- Suprasellar arachnoid cysts (SACs) and third ventricular cysts (3VCs) can cause obstructive hydrocephalus, necessitating prompt surgical intervention.
- Accurate differentiation between SACs and 3VCs is crucial for effective treatment.
Purpose of the Study:
- To describe and contrast the imaging characteristics of SACs and 3VCs.
- To present stepwise endoscopic surgical approaches for SACs and 3VCs.
- To highlight key anatomical features for distinguishing between these cyst types.
Main Methods:
- Review of patients with SACs and 3VCs presenting with obstructive hydrocephalus.
- Endoscopic intraventricular cyst resection.
- Magnetic resonance imaging analysis of anatomical differences.
- Video demonstrations of surgical techniques.
Main Results:
- Endoscopic resection led to long-term resolution of hydrocephalus and symptoms in studied patients.
- Distinct imaging features differentiate SACs from 3VCs.
- Stepwise surgical approaches were demonstrated for both cyst types.
Conclusions:
- Safe endoscopic treatment of SACs and 3VCs depends on a deep understanding of their anatomical impact.
- Knowledge of how each cyst distorts the third ventricle and suprasellar cistern is vital.
- A tailored, anatomy-based surgical approach ensures optimal outcomes.

Cranial Bones: Superior and Posterior View
The frontal bone is the single bone that forms the forehead. At its anterior midline, between the eyebrows, there is a slight depression called the glabella. The frontal bone also forms the supraorbital margin of the orbit. Near the middle of this margin is the supraorbital foramen, the opening that provides passage for a sensory nerve to the forehead.
